Crockpot Chicken & Gravy

  • Author: Olivia
  • Total Time: 6 hours 5 minutes
  • Yield: 4-6 servings
  • Diet: Gluten Free

Description

Crockpot Chicken & Gravy is a savory, no-fuss comfort food classic made with tender chicken slow-cooked in a rich, seasoned gravy. With just a handful of pantry staples, this hearty dish is perfect for busy weeknights and pairs beautifully with mashed potatoes, rice, or biscuits.


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 pounds boneless, skinless chicken breasts

  • 2 packets chicken gravy mix (approx. 1 ounce each)

  • 1 can (10.5 oz) cream of chicken soup

  • 2 cups low-sodium chicken broth

  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der

  • 1 teaspoon onion powder

  • Salt and pepper, to taste

  • Fresh parsley, chopped, for garnish (optional)


Instructions

  • In a medium bowl, whisk together chicken gravy mix, cream of chicken soup, chicken broth, garlic powder, and onion powder until smooth.

  • Place chicken breasts in the bottom of a crockpot.

  • Pour the gravy mixture over the chicken, making sure it’s well covered.

  • Cover and cook on low for 6–7 hours or high for 3–4 hours, until chicken is tender and fully cooked.

  • Remove chicken, shred or slice, then return it to the slow cooker and stir to coat in gravy.

  • Serve warm over mashed potatoes, rice, or noodles. Garnish with fresh parsley if desired.

Notes

  • Add a splash of milk or cream at the end for extra richness.

  • Great for meal prep—store leftovers in the fridge for up to 4 days.

  • Can substitute chicken thighs for even more flavor.
